Understanding the Unique Scheduling Needs of Manchester Fitness Businesses
Manchester’s fitness market has distinct characteristics that directly impact scheduling requirements for local gyms. The city’s four-season climate creates predictable demand fluctuations, with January resolution crowds, summer slowdowns, and weather-related attendance patterns. Additionally, Manchester’s growing young professional population means peak gym times often cluster around early mornings, lunch hours, and after-work periods. Understanding these patterns is essential for creating effective shift schedules that align staff availability with member demand.
- Seasonal Variations: Manchester gyms experience up to 40% membership increases in January, requiring flexible scheduling capabilities to accommodate the influx without overstaffing during slower months.
- Diverse Service Offerings: From specialized HIIT studios to traditional weightlifting facilities, Manchester gyms need scheduling systems that accommodate various class types, equipment usage, and instructor specializations.
- University Influence: With multiple higher education institutions nearby, Manchester gyms often experience schedule disruptions aligned with academic calendars and student availability.
- Competitive Market: The city’s growing fitness scene means gyms must optimize schedules to offer convenient class times and availability that differentiate them from competitors.
- Weather Considerations: New Hampshire’s variable weather patterns affect gym attendance, requiring adaptive scheduling tools that can quickly adjust to unexpected surges or drops in attendance.

Data-Driven Decision Making for Fitness Business Optimization
Advanced scheduling systems generate valuable data that Manchester gym owners can leverage for better business decisions. By analyzing scheduling patterns, attendance rates, and resource utilization, fitness businesses can identify opportunities for optimization and growth. The insights derived from scheduling data help inform strategic decisions about staffing levels, class offerings, and operational hours.
- Attendance Analytics: Track class attendance rates by time, day, format, and instructor to identify the most popular offerings and potential schedule improvements.
- Utilization Reports: Measure studio and equipment usage rates to identify underutilized resources or opportunities for expanded offerings.
- Staff Performance Metrics: Evaluate instructor effectiveness based on class attendance rates, retention, and member feedback to inform coaching or staffing decisions.
- Demand Forecasting: Use historical booking data to predict future demand patterns and proactively adjust schedules for seasonal fluctuations or growth trends.
- Revenue Analysis: Identify the most profitable classes, time slots, and services to optimize the schedule for maximum financial return.
Implementing schedule optimization metrics allows Manchester gym owners to make evidence-based decisions rather than relying on assumptions or tradition. For example, data might reveal that a 5:30 AM class consistently outperforms the 6:30 AM slot, or that certain instructors drive significantly higher attendance regardless of class format. These insights enable continuous schedule refinement that aligns with actual member behaviors and preferences.
Implementing and Transitioning to New Scheduling Systems
Transitioning from manual scheduling or outdated systems to modern scheduling software requires careful planning and execution. Manchester gym owners should approach this process strategically to minimize disruption to both staff workflows and member experiences. A phased implementation approach often yields the best results, allowing for adjustments based on user feedback before full deployment.
- Needs Assessment: Begin by documenting specific scheduling requirements, pain points, and goals to ensure the selected solution addresses your gym’s unique needs.
- Staff Training: Invest in comprehensive training for all staff members who will use the system, with particular attention to those responsible for creating and maintaining schedules.
- Data Migration: Carefully transfer existing schedule information, member data, and historical records to maintain continuity and preserve valuable business intelligence.
- Member Communication: Develop a clear communication plan to inform members about new booking procedures, account setup, and the benefits they’ll experience from the improved system.
- Parallel Processing: Consider running both old and new systems simultaneously during an initial transition period to prevent scheduling gaps or confusion.
